San Jose 76, Los Angeles 70

AMIGOS REMAIN UNBEATEN

LOS ANGELES -- The San Jose Fighting Amigos (now 7-0) became the first team to clinch a Season 51 playoff spot, as they completed the season sweep of the defending champion Los Angeles club (now 3-4) with a 76-70 victory.

The win, which also clinches the West Division title for San Jose, featured a first half of wild swings, with San Jose taking the first quarter 28-13 while L.A. responded with a 25-12 second quarter run.

The second half was nip and tuck until the fourth quarter when Hall of Fame guard Jesse Shershot of San Jose finally broke free of the defensive grip of Great Gruncle Terry to deliver 11 of his 13 points, including all 3 treys he buried in this game.

PLAYER OF THE GAME

28 GVP...Third-year star forward CRENTIS "THE" DENTIST of Los Angeles dominated his opponent, Lupalin Greenbeard, scoring a team-high 18 points on 8 of 11 shooting that included 2 for 2 at the foul stripe. Dentist filled the defensive role for his team as well, blocking a game-high 3 shots and getting a steal. He also grabbed 3 boards.


Other 20-plus GVP performers
27 GVP...Despite having multiple buckets removed by the defense of Great Gruncle Terry, San Jose Hall of Famer Jesse Shershot played magnificently, as the 6-5 shooting guard grabbed a game-high 10 rebounds, handed out a team-high (tied) 3 assists, registered 1 steal and scored 13 points, with 11 coming in the decisive fourth quarter, including all three of his bombs. 

24 GVP...With Terry shadowing Shershot, San Jose needed 15-year point guard Cremeofsum Yunguy to provide some points, and the veteran did just that, scoring 16, dishing a team-high (tied) 3 assists, pulling down 4 boards and getting 1 steal.

23 GVP...San Jose center Twinkles Spatula matched All-MBA center Quick Tink bucket for bucket, scoring 18 points, grabbing 4 boards and coming up with 1 steal.

22 GVP...Having the best scoring season of his solid career, Eddie "the Milkman" Creamer continued his points production in this big game, getting a game-high 19 points and dominating none other than Christ Almighty. Second in the league in scoring behind teammate Shershot, Creamer also pulled down 3 boards.

20 GVP...Having another All-MBA season at center, Los Angeles pivot Quick Tink scored 16 points, grabbed 3 boards and had 1 assist.
